How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pacific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pacific Beach Studio Apartments | $2,298 | $1,084 | $3,773 |
| Pacific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,889 | $1,180 | $8,033 |
| Pacific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,510 | $2,200 | $9,630 |
| Pacific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,562 | $3,275 | $10,000+ |
| Pacific Beach 4 Bedroom Apartments | $10,476 | $4,995 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pacific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Pacific Beach?
There are currently 897 Studio Apartments in Pacific Beach with rent ranges from $1,084 to $3,773 with an average price of $2,298.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pacific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pacific Beach ranges from $1,180 to $8,033 with an average monthly rent of $2,889.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pacific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pacific Beach range from $2,200 to $9,630.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,510.
How expensive are Pacific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 232 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pacific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,275 to $34,997 - averaging $6,562 for the location.
